Coordinated computer reporting of clinical microbiology data

A A Eggert, G Smulka, L Walker

    American Journal of Clinical Pathology
    |July 1, 1981
    PubMed
    Summary

    Integrating microbiology data into lab reports improves clarity and workflow. Optimizing computer systems enhances technologist satisfaction and system usage for better combined reports.

    Area of Science:

    • Medical Laboratory Science
    • Clinical Microbiology

    Background:

    • Laboratory cumulative reports require enhanced readability and style for effective microbiology information incorporation.
    • Optimizing laboratory workflow around computer record-keeping systems is crucial for technologist satisfaction and system adoption in microbiology.

    Purpose of the Study:

    • To discuss efforts and results of extending a commercially available system in a microbiology laboratory.
    • To compare this extension with another approach using the same system base.
    • To summarize necessary software modifications for system enhancement.

    Main Methods:

    • Extension of a commercially available computer record-keeping system.
    • Comparison of workflow and technologist satisfaction between two system implementation approaches.
    • Software modification for system optimization.

    Main Results:

    • The project resulted in a smooth laboratory workflow.
    • Highly successful combined reports were achieved.
    • Technologist satisfaction and system usage were positively impacted.

    Conclusions:

    • Enhancing the integration of microbiology information into laboratory reports is important.
    • Optimizing computer systems and workflow is essential for successful laboratory information management.
    • System modifications can lead to improved efficiency and report quality.
